Crimson psyche

Hilburn, Lynda2014
Books
Psychologist Kismet Knight's life changed for ever when she discovered a preternatural underworld and became involved with gorgeous, centuries-old Devereux, the powerful leader of a vampire coven. But it's brought her plenty of new, undead clients and a certain amount of notoriety. When she agrees to what she believes is just another radio interview, she finds she's completely mistaken. And while Maxie Westhaven, a tabloid newspaper reporter in search of a juicy story, is befriending Kismet, leading her into a bizarre world of role-players and lost souls, Luna, Devereux's hostile femme fatale PA recognises the perfect opportunity to throw a wrench into her boss's blossoming relationship with the human shrink.
